    Hello,

    I have been looking at which coilovers to install with the intent of eventually addind an ARB bumper and winch. From what I have read the SAW's use a 650 lb spring and should be good to go when I add the extra weight, but I may have to crank it up a bit to bring it back to level.

    I was looking at the ICON site, an it said something to the effect that it may be a no go with a winch / bumper as it will make the front sag.

    Do the ICON / DR co's use a lighter weight spring? What is the spring weight? Will I be good to go with the ICON 2.5?


    One a side note, is there any difference in the C/O's that say DR on them and the newer ones which say ICON, or just the leftover stock from Donahoe?
